Rafting
Rafting with Adventure Norway is on the Mandal River starting in Bjelland. The river is grade 2/3 which makes it an ideal choice for people wishing to try rafting for the first time. While the river gives us lots of fun and surprises it is an extremely safe river which allows us to take children from 6 years old.
We have experienced and highly trained guides who are annually updated with river rescue and safety courses. The guides make the trip so if your looking for more adventure and excitement let them know, they have a multitude of games and adventures that you can take part in as we raft down the river. br>

Pro Rafting
The 2 man pro rafts offer greater challenges as you have to control the boat yourself and you have to work with your partner. You will either have a guide with you or be part of a flotilla with rafts.
We meet at Adventure Norway rafting centre in Hessa, you will be given a brief about the trip We start on a section of flat water where we take time to cover all the safety aspects and prepare everyone for the trip.
The pro raft trip then takes us 6km down the unspoilt Mandal river, away from the bustle of everyday life. We finish back at Hessa, get changed and enjoy reflections of the trip over a coffee or cold drink. br>

Climbing
Just a short walk from our centre in Hessa, we have a great climbing crag on the banks of the Mandal River. There is a selection of bolted climbs with top ropes and several free climbs. We are further developing the climbing area this season with several multi pitch routes.
The climbing is suitable for people with no previous experience. We meet at the rafting centre in Hessa and have a 15 minute briefing. Then we fit harnesses and walk 400m to the crag. After a safety brief we start by learning the fig8 knot and how to belay (protect the person climbing). Once all the safety is complete we spend time climbing and practising different technique. br>

Abseiling
Just a short walk from our centre in Hessa, we have a great climbing crag on the banks of the Mandal River. From the top of the crag we have a 30metre abseil with an overhang allowing the last 10metres free abseil.
To abseil is a method of descending a cliff under your own control. You will receive all the safety information and training then you control your own descent. Your guide will have you on a safety rope throughout and have control of you, so you have double security. In this controlled environment abseiling is 100% safe. Although you know your 100% safe the adrenalin still kicks in as you step backwards of a 30 metre high cliff. br>

Wire
Just 3 minutes walk south of the rafting centre in Hessa we have a 70 metre long wire spanning the Mandal River. The wire is between 4 and 8 metres above the river. From the west bank you are clipped onto a runner on the wire from your harness.
Then a big step into the unknown and you're speeding across the river like superman. You come to a stop at the far end and are pulled back. br>

Canoeing
From the rafting centre in Hessa our canoe tours start. The river is grade 1 on this section, it is moving but no waves. This makes it suitable for people with no previous canoe experience.
The tour is 6km and finishes on the banks of Manfla Lake. Our canoes have 3 seats and are suitable for 2 adults and a child. This tour lasts about 3 hours, but you can hire the canoe for the whole day and explore further upstream and around the lake taking a picnic with you. br>

Elk Safari
The Norwegian elk are beautiful wild animals. They live in the forest alone or in small groups. They are shy animals and therefore quite elusive. This is our 5th year of running safaris and we now have a good knowledge of where and when to find our local elk.
We meet at the rafting centre in Hessa, Bjelland at 10pm where we give a 15minute presentation on the elk, their habits and habitat. The safari takes approximately 2 hours and we travel about 30km. We will be in the minibus for the duration of the safari so suitable clothing is all you require. You can take binoculars and cameras. br>
